SACRAMENTO COUNTY, CA (MPG) - Sacramento County's Department of Child, Family, and Adult Services is encouraging community groups to apply for AARP's Livable Communities Grant Program, known as the AARP Community Challenge. Since launching in 2017, the program has helped invest millions of dollars into communities across the United States.

Grant applications are open until March 6, 2024. Nonprofits and other community organizations are encouraged to apply.

Key Dates for the 2024 application process include:

-March 6: Application window closes

-June 26: Selected grantees announced

-December 15: completion of all projects

There are three grant opportunities:

-Flagship Grants are for projects that especially benefit community members who are 50 or older.

-Capacity-Building Microgrants are worth $2,500 and benefit residents through bike audits, walk audits, and HomeFit Modifications.

-Demonstration Grants support community-based projects in different categories.
